1. Introduction to Detoxification: A Clinical Perspective
The term "detox" is widely used in wellness culture, often associated with restrictive cleanses, juice fasts, and extreme dietary protocols. From a clinical perspective, however, detoxification is a continuous, innate physiological process. This chapter aims to reframe the concept by grounding it in evidence-based biology, separating established science from popular claims, and outlining a realistic foundation for a supportive 14-day routine.
In medical terms, detoxification refers primarily to the body's sophisticated systems for neutralizing and eliminating potentially harmful substances. These endogenous processes are ongoing and do not require extreme external intervention to "start" or "reset." The key organs involved include:
- The Liver: The primary site for biotransformation, where enzymes convert fat-soluble toxins into water-soluble compounds for excretion.
- The Kidneys: Filter the blood, excreting waste products and water-soluble metabolites via urine.
- The Gastrointestinal Tract: Eliminates waste and houses the gut microbiome, which plays a role in metabolizing various compounds.
- The Skin and Lungs: Provide secondary routes of elimination through sweat and exhalation.
The core premise of a realistic, evidence-informed approach is not to override these systems but to support their optimal function by reducing the body's toxic load and providing the nutrients necessary for their enzymatic pathways. This is a shift from a short-term "purge" to a sustainable practice of reducing exposure and enhancing resilience.
Clinical Insight: It is crucial to distinguish between the body's natural detoxification pathways and commercial "detox" products. Many over-the-counter cleanses or teas lack robust clinical trials demonstrating efficacy for "cleansing" beyond their basic laxative or diuretic effects. A clinically responsible approach focuses on foundational health habits: hydration, balanced nutrition rich in phytonutrients, adequate fiber, and sleep—all of which are well-supported by evidence for supporting organ function.
Individuals with pre-existing health conditions should exercise particular caution and consult a physician before beginning any new regimen. This includes those with kidney or liver disease, diabetes, a history of eating disorders, or individuals taking multiple medications, as dietary changes can affect metabolism and drug efficacy.
This clinical perspective sets the stage for the following chapters, which will detail practical, non-extreme routines designed to reduce dietary and environmental burdens while nourishing the body's inherent capacity for self-regulation.
2. Mechanisms and Evidence Behind Detoxification
The term "detox" is often used in wellness circles, but from a clinical perspective, it refers to the body's innate, continuous physiological processes for neutralizing and eliminating potentially harmful substances. The primary organs involved are the liver, kidneys, gastrointestinal tract, skin, and lungs. A realistic 14-day plan should aim to support, not replace, these existing systems.
Core Physiological Mechanisms
The liver is the central hub, metabolizing toxins through two main phases:
- Phase I (Transformation): Enzymes, primarily from the cytochrome P450 family, chemically alter fat-soluble compounds to make them more reactive.
- Phase II (Conjugation): These reactive intermediates are bound to other molecules (like glutathione or sulfate) to become water-soluble and less harmful, ready for excretion.
The kidneys then filter these water-soluble byproducts from the blood into urine. The GI tract eliminates waste via bile and stool, while the skin and lungs expel volatile compounds.
Expert Insight: Clinicians view "detox support" as optimizing the function of these organs through evidence-based lifestyle measures. The goal is reducing the overall "toxic load"—the cumulative burden from dietary choices, environmental exposures, and metabolic byproducts—to allow the body's natural systems to operate more efficiently.
Evaluating the Evidence for Common "Detox" Strategies
Evidence for popular detox routines varies significantly in quality and scope.
- Strongly Supported: Increased water intake supports kidney filtration. A diet rich in fiber (from vegetables, fruits, legumes) promotes regular bowel movements and may bind to certain toxins in the gut, aiding their excretion. Reducing intake of ultra-processed foods, alcohol, and added sugars directly lowers the metabolic burden on the liver.
- Mixed or Preliminary Evidence: Claims about specific "superfoods" or juices dramatically accelerating detoxification are often overstated. While certain compounds in foods like cruciferous vegetables (e.g., sulforaphane) can upregulate protective Phase II enzymes in laboratory studies, the clinical translation to a short-term "detox" effect in humans is not firmly established.
- Lacking Evidence / Potentially Harmful: Extreme fasting, prolonged juicing, or aggressive colon cleanses lack robust evidence for enhancing detoxification and can cause electrolyte imbalances, nutrient deficiencies, and disrupt gut microbiota.
Who Should Exercise Caution: Individuals with pre-existing liver or kidney disease, diabetes, a history of eating disorders, or those who are pregnant or breastfeeding should consult a physician before making significant dietary or lifestyle changes, even within a moderate 14-day plan. Those on multiple medications should also seek advice due to potential nutrient-drug interactions.
The most realistic approach is to view a 14-day period as a structured opportunity to adopt habits that sustainably reduce the daily burden on your detoxification organs, rather than seeking a drastic, short-term purge.
3. Risks and Populations to Avoid Detox Programs
While the concept of a "detox" is popular, it is crucial to approach any restrictive program with a clear understanding of its potential risks. The human body possesses highly efficient detoxification systems—primarily the liver, kidneys, lungs, and skin—that function continuously. Most commercial or self-directed detox programs lack robust scientific evidence for their claimed systemic cleansing benefits and can pose significant health hazards, particularly for certain populations.
Common Risks Associated with Restrictive Detox Programs
Programs that severely limit calories, promote excessive juice consumption, or rely heavily on laxatives or diuretics can lead to several adverse effects:
- Nutrient Deficiencies: Short-term programs can lead to inadequate intake of essential proteins, fats, vitamins, and minerals, potentially causing fatigue, dizziness, and impaired immune function.
- Electrolyte Imbalances: Diarrhea from laxatives or excessive fluid intake without proper electrolyte replacement can disrupt sodium, potassium, and magnesium levels, risking cardiac arrhythmias, muscle cramps, and confusion.
- Metabolic Disruption: Severe calorie restriction can slow metabolism as the body enters a conservation state, which may lead to rapid weight regain post-program.
- Gastrointestinal Distress: Abrupt changes in fiber intake or the use of harsh herbal supplements can cause significant bloating, cramping, and altered bowel habits.
Populations Who Should Avoid or Exercise Extreme Caution
For some individuals, the risks of a detox program far outweigh any unproven benefits. Medical consultation is absolutely essential before considering any such regimen for those with:
- Preexisting Medical Conditions: This includes individuals with diabetes, kidney disease, liver disease, heart conditions, or autoimmune disorders. Dietary changes can dangerously affect medication efficacy and disease management.
- Pregnant or Breastfeeding Women: Nutritional demands are significantly higher during these periods. Restrictive diets can jeopardize fetal and infant development.
- Individuals with a History of Eating Disorders: The restrictive and rule-based nature of detox programs can trigger disordered eating patterns and relapse.
- Children and Adolescents: Their growing bodies require consistent, high-quality nutrition; restrictive diets can impair growth and development.
- Those on Multiple Medications (Polypharmacy): Detox supplements or drastic dietary shifts can alter how medications are metabolized, leading to reduced efficacy or toxicity.
Clinical Perspective: From a medical standpoint, the most sustainable and evidence-based approach to supporting the body's natural detoxification pathways is not a short-term extreme program, but consistent, long-term habits. This includes adequate hydration, consumption of fiber-rich fruits and vegetables, regular physical activity to promote circulation and sweating, and limiting processed foods, alcohol, and environmental toxins where possible. Any program that promises rapid "cleansing" should be viewed with skepticism, and its protocols should be critically evaluated for safety.
In summary, a responsible approach to health recognizes that "detoxing" is not an event but a consequence of daily lifestyle choices. For the populations listed above, and indeed for anyone, focusing on balanced, nutrient-dense eating and consulting with a healthcare provider or registered dietitian is a far safer and more effective strategy than embarking on an unverified detox program.
4. Practical Evidence-Based Routines for a 14-Day Detox
An evidence-based approach to a 14-day reset focuses on supporting the body's intrinsic detoxification systems—primarily the liver, kidneys, digestive tract, and skin—through consistent, manageable routines. The goal is not an extreme purge but the reduction of metabolic burden and the promotion of systemic homeostasis.
Core Daily Pillars
Establishing these foundational habits provides the structure for effective physiological support.
- Hydration Protocol: Consume 2-3 liters of water daily, ideally starting with 500ml upon waking. Adequate hydration is strongly supported by evidence for kidney function and bowel regularity. Adding a slice of lemon may stimulate bile flow, though direct "detox" claims are not conclusively proven.
- Fiber-Focused Nutrition: Prioritize 25-35 grams of fiber daily from diverse sources: cruciferous vegetables (broccoli, kale), whole fruits, legumes, and whole grains like oats. This supports the enterohepatic circulation by binding to waste products for excretion.
- Consistent Sleep-Wake Cycle: Aim for 7-9 hours of sleep per night, going to bed and waking at consistent times. Sleep is critical for glymphatic system activity, which clears metabolic waste from the brain.
Incorporating Supportive Practices
These elements, while beneficial, should be integrated based on individual tolerance and evidence strength.
- Targeted Phytonutrients: Include foods rich in sulforaphane (e.g., broccoli sprouts) and flavonoids (e.g., berries, green tea). These compounds upregulate Phase II liver detoxification enzymes, a mechanism supported by cellular and some human studies.
- Mindful Movement: Engage in daily, moderate activity such as 30 minutes of brisk walking, cycling, or yoga. This promotes circulation and lymphatic drainage. Avoid exhaustive exercise, which can increase oxidative stress.
- Reduced Exposures: A practical, evidence-informed goal is to minimize intake of ultra-processed foods, added sugars, and alcohol. This directly reduces the metabolic load on the liver.
Clinical Perspective: The term "detox" is often misapplied. From a medical standpoint, this routine is best viewed as a period of dietary and lifestyle optimization to reduce allostatic load. The evidence is strongest for the benefits of increased fiber, hydration, and whole foods. Claims about specific foods "pulling toxins from fat cells" are not substantiated. The body's detoxification pathways are constant, not something switched on only by a 14-day plan.
Important Precautions: Individuals with pre-existing kidney or liver disease, diabetes, electrolyte imbalances, or a history of eating disorders should consult a physician before making significant dietary changes. Those on medication, especially blood thinners or drugs metabolized by the cytochrome P450 system, should seek advice due to potential interactions with certain phytonutrients.
5. Safety Monitoring and Indications for Medical Consultation
Any dietary or lifestyle modification, including a 14-day reset, requires attentive self-monitoring and an understanding of when to seek professional guidance. The goal is to support your body's intrinsic processes, not to override them or ignore warning signs.
Essential Self-Monitoring Parameters
Pay close attention to how you feel, not just the scale. Documenting these factors can provide valuable insight:
- Energy & Mood: Note fluctuations. Initial fatigue or irritability can occur but should not be severe or persistent.
- Digestive Changes: Mild changes in bowel habits are common with increased fiber or fluid intake. Severe diarrhea, constipation, or abdominal pain are not.
- Hydration Status: Monitor urine color (aim for pale yellow) and frequency. Increased water intake is typical, but excessive thirst can be a red flag.
- Sleep Quality: Improved sleep is a positive sign. Significant disruption is a signal to reassess your routine.
Clinical Perspective: From a medical standpoint, "detox" is not a clinical diagnosis for most people with functioning liver and kidneys. The value of a structured reset lies in breaking poor dietary habits and reducing processed food intake. Monitoring is crucial to distinguish normal adaptation from potential harm, such as electrolyte imbalance or inadequate caloric intake.
Clear Indications for Medical Consultation
Discontinue the program and consult a physician or registered dietitian if you experience any of the following:
- Dizziness, lightheadedness, fainting, or heart palpitations.
- Severe or persistent headache, nausea, or vomiting.
- Signs of dehydration (extreme thirst, very dark urine, infrequent urination).
- Mental fog, confusion, or extreme fatigue that impedes daily function.
Who Should Consult a Doctor Before Starting
Certain individuals should seek medical advice prior to beginning any detox-style program due to increased risks:
- Individuals with chronic conditions (e.g., diabetes, kidney disease, liver disease, heart conditions).
- Those taking prescription medications, especially for diabetes, blood pressure, or blood thinners.
- Pregnant or breastfeeding women.
- Individuals with a history of eating disorders or disordered eating.
- Anyone recovering from illness or surgery.
Evidence supporting the necessity of extreme "detox" protocols is limited. The most sustainable and safe approach focuses on whole foods, hydration, and manageable habit change, with professional oversight when needed.
6. Questions & Expert Insights
Is a 14-day detox necessary for my body to "cleanse" itself?
The concept of a "detox" as a necessary external process is largely a misnomer. Your body has highly efficient, built-in detoxification systems—primarily the liver, kidneys, digestive tract, lungs, and skin—that work continuously. A well-structured 14-day program is better viewed as a dietary reset that supports these natural functions by reducing the intake of processed foods, added sugars, and alcohol while increasing hydration and nutrient-dense whole foods. The perceived benefits, such as improved energy and digestion, are likely due to this shift toward healthier habits, not the removal of unspecified "toxins." There is limited high-quality evidence supporting commercial detox protocols for long-term health outcomes beyond the benefits of the underlying dietary improvements.
What are the potential risks or side effects, and who should avoid this approach?
Even a "non-extreme" detox can carry risks, particularly if it involves severe calorie restriction, excessive juicing, or unregulated supplements. Common side effects include headaches, fatigue, irritability, dizziness, and digestive disturbances, often stemming from caffeine withdrawal or a sudden drop in calorie and carbohydrate intake. Certain individuals should avoid detox programs or only undertake them under direct medical supervision. This includes individuals with kidney or liver disease, diabetes, a history of eating disorders, those who are pregnant or breastfeeding, and individuals on multiple medications (polypharmacy), where dietary changes can alter drug metabolism.
When should I talk to my doctor before starting, and what should I discuss?
Consult your primary care physician or a registered dietitian before starting if you have any chronic health condition, take regular medications, or have significant health concerns. This is non-negotiable for the groups mentioned above. Come to the appointment prepared to discuss: 1) The specific plan you intend to follow (bring the routine or a summary), 2) Your complete list of medications and supplements, 3) Your personal health goals for the program. This allows your doctor to assess for potential nutrient deficiencies, dangerous interactions (e.g., with blood thinners or diabetes medications), and whether the plan is appropriate for your individual physiology. They can also help you modify the plan to be safer and more effective for your needs.
Will a short-term detox lead to lasting weight loss or health improvements?
Any rapid weight loss during a 14-day period is predominantly from water weight and glycogen depletion, not sustainable fat loss. Lasting health improvements are achieved through consistent, long-term lifestyle changes, not short-term interventions. The true value of a well-designed reset is as a behavioral catalyst—it can help break cycles of poor eating, reduce sugar cravings, and introduce you to foods and routines you can integrate permanently. To make benefits last, you must have a clear, realistic plan for what comes after the 14 days. Without a transition to a balanced, maintainable diet, any positive effects will be temporary.
